Kaneri
About Kaneri
According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Kaneri village is 538520. Kaneri village is located in Armori tehsil of Gadchiroli district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Armori (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Gadchiroli. As per 2009 stats, Jogisakhara is the gram panchayat of Kaneri village.
The total geographical area of village is 63.94 hectares. Kaneri has a total population of 378 peoples, out of which male population is 183 while female population is 195.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 1065 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of kaneri village is 67.46% out of which 74.86% males and 60.51% females are literate. There are about 90 houses in kaneri village.
Desaiganj is nearest town to kaneri village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.

Population of Kaneri
The population details of Kaneri cover important figures like total population, male and female population, children aged 0–6 years, and the number of literate and illiterate people. It also shows how many residents belong to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es. These details help in understanding the village structure, education level, and community gro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 378 | 183 | 195 |
Child Population (Age 0–6) | 36 | 18 | 18 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) Population | 12 | 7 | 5 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population | 210 | 98 | 112 |
Literate Population | 255 | 137 | 118 |
Illiterate Population | 123 | 46 | 77 |
